java开发小程序需要哪些技术支持

Java是一种流行的编程语言,常用于开发各种类型的应用程序,包括小程序。小程序是近年来兴起的一种应用形式,可以提供基本的服务,并为用户提供提供良好的使用体验。开发Java小程序需要以下技术支持:

1. Java基础知识

作为一名Java开发者,要想开发Java小程序必须掌握Java语言的基本知识,包括Java面向对象的特性、Java语言规范、Java集合、Java IO等。

2. 数据库知识

开发小程序需要对数据进行存储和访问,所以需要对数据库有一定的了解,如MySQL、Oracle等,这样才能设计出合适的数据结构及数据库操作语句。

3. Java Web技术

开发Java小程序需要掌握Web技术,例如Servlet、JSP、HTML、CSS、JavaScript等。其中,Servlet是JavaWeb的基石,JSP可作为Servlet的补充,两者结合可以实现动态Web应用程序。

4. 客户端开发技术

小程序可有特殊的用户界面,所以还需要掌握用户界面开发技术,如Swing、JavaFX等,这些技术可以创建良好的用户界面,提高用户体验。

5. 测试框架

一个好的测试框架可以有效地保障程序的质量,因此,开发小程序时需要掌握一些测试框架技术,如Junit、TestNG等。

6. 微信开发技术

如果你正在开发微信小程序,那么你需要熟悉微信开发技术,包括微信公众号平台API、微信小程序API、微信支付API等。微信的开放平台提供了详细的开发文档和示例代码供开发者使用,使得我们可以快速开发小程序。

总之,以上技术是开发Java小程序的基础,为了让小程序更加实用和完善,还需要开发者不断学习和探索其他技术,如网络编程、性能优化等等。只有不断地学习和实践,才能成为一名有竞争力的Java开发者,开发出优秀的小程序。